Mr David Njoroge  

Mr. David Njoroge 
Chair Finance & Investment committee

David Njoroge

NAIROBI WEATHER
500 Internal Server Error

Oops!

That pulled a fast one on us...

take me home
Photo by Pok Rie from Pexels
NAIROBI WEATHER